Handover note — telemetry compression, from Darian to Wrenna. The Pulsegrid collectors now zstd-compress payloads above 2 KB before signing; anything smaller ships raw to avoid overhead. The signing step happens post-compression, so verify digests against the compressed bytes. Dictionary updates deploy weekly. To unlock the verifier's key store during review, the recovery prompt expects the passphrase given below.

vault phrase of tajef-tafog = istox-sorax-zorox-casok-holox-kelix-weneth-drueth-casion

### Step 4: Update the Pipecrest validator configuration

Before routing feeds through the new Pipecrest validator, each ingestion node must be updated, as the legacy validator ignores enclosure checksums that the new one enforces. Apply this step only after Step 3's schema migration has finished, or feeds will fail validation with misleading errors. Note that strict mode is now on by default, so plan for a spike in rejected feeds. The values to apply on each node are below.

service settings:
[casax]
port = 6379
team = rusir
host = casax.zemvarhq.corp
region = outer-4
access_code = ac_9808ce
timeout_ms = 1500

Ticket: Payroll export drift on Ledgerbine

Prod and staging disagree on the Ledgerbine export format since the v7 column change. Staging emits the new fixed-width layout; prod still writes delimited files, so the Ostwick clearing job rejects half the batches. Needs reconciliation before Friday's run. Do not patch prod manually. Current prod values follow.

config for kawif-hahig:
zorix:
  log_level: error
  metrics_host: metrics.zorix.lumiclabs.internal
  pool_size: 16

When both sides edit the same event, the CONFLICT_POLICY variable decides the winner; we default to `remote_wins` because Tidewheel timestamps are unreliable across daylight transitions. Future maintainers: never change this without re-running the reconciliation suite, as silent data loss is possible. The bridge also requires an API credential to authenticate against Fernhaven, and that value must appear on the line directly below this sentence.

env line for fafof-fahag: LEDGER_TOKEN5=f8790